Pyar Diwana is a 1972 Bollywood comedy film[1] directed by Samar Chatterjee.[2] The film stars Kishore Kumar, Mumtaz in lead roles.[3][4][5]

It is a love story a young wealthy boy Sunil who falls in love with his classmate Mamta. Sunil’s family is against their relationship because they wants other girl in their choice as Sunil's wife.[6]
